Jvm
TangShangWen
这个作者很懒,什么都没留下…
展开
-
JVM垃圾收集器和内存分配侧策略
垃圾收集器和内存分配侧策略 很多人会有疑问,为什么垃圾收集的机制已经实现了自动化,我们还需要去了解GC和内存分配的么? 回答的答案就是: 当需要排查各种内存溢出、内存泄漏问题的时候,当垃圾收集成为系统达到更能高并发量的瓶颈的时候,我们就需要对这些所谓的自动化进行调节。 如何判断对象已死? 由于堆里面放着Java对象的实例,在垃圾收集器对堆进行回收之前,首先就要确定这些对象还有哪些原创 2013-10-17 14:38:40 · 1070 阅读 · 0 评论 -
虚拟机类加载机制
本篇文章讲述虚拟机如何加载Class文件和Class文件中的信息进入到虚拟机后会发生什么变化 1.类加载的时机 类被加载到虚拟机的内存中,他的整个生命周期包含了:加载(Loading)、验证(Verification)、准备(Preparation)、解析(Resolution)、初始化(Initialization)、使用(Using)和卸载(Unloading)七个阶段,其中验证、准备和解原创 2013-10-23 02:16:00 · 977 阅读 · 0 评论